Soma (carisoprodol) for Muscle Spasm: I have a few degenerated disks and fibromyalgia. These two conditions tend amplify each other; causing extreme back pain. Some antidepressants/anti-anxiety meds will address fibromyalgia but they only work 24/7; the inherent sedation is not a wonderful way to go through life. With Soma I can take care of this later in the day and because it amplifies opiates am able to take Tramadol instead of Percocet. Be careful with that interaction as it is surprisingly powerful. Be careful of using any other drugs as well while on Soma. Although it is mildly euphoric I have not detected any physical or psychological addiction. Also, you may find Soma "vacations" to increase its effectiveness during long term use.
